Telehealth and Behavioral Health in Louisville

The integration of telehealth services in Louisville Behavioral Health has proven to be a transformative approach. According to a report by the Kentucky Office of Behavioral Health, telehealth has bridged gaps in care, especially for rural populations. By leveraging technology, behavioral health providers can reach patients who might otherwise struggle to access in-person services. This approach not only increases accessibility but also provides continuity of care, which is essential for the treatment of chronic mental health conditions.

Telehealth has also facilitated real-time monitoring of patients through remote check-ins and virtual therapy sessions. These services have become especially vital during the COVID-19 pandemic, as they have allowed for the safe continuation of mental health care while minimizing exposure risks. Moreover, telehealth services have proven to be cost-effective, reducing the need for frequent in-person visits and thereby alleviating the burden on local healthcare infrastructure.

Data-Driven Approaches to Behavioral Health

Data-driven methodologies are revolutionizing behavioral health services in Louisville. The utilization of advanced analytics allows for the identification of trends and patterns in mental health issues, enabling more targeted interventions. For example, by analyzing data from electronic health records, mental health providers can identify communities with higher incidences of depression or anxiety, thereby enabling targeted outreach programs.

Additionally, machine learning algorithms can predict which patients are at risk of relapse, allowing for proactive management. Such predictive analytics can optimize resource allocation by ensuring that high-risk patients receive timely support. The integration of data science in behavioral health not only improves patient outcomes but also enhances the efficiency of service delivery, making it a highly effective strategy in the current health care environment.
